On Mon, 2008-03-17 at 00:56 +0000, Simos Xenitellis wrote: > On Sun, Mar 16, 2008 at 11:25 PM, Bastien Nocera <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> > > > On Sun, 2008-03-16 at 14:02 +0000, Simos Xenitellis wrote: > > <snip> > > > > > That is a saving of at least 3M in memory. > > > > > > The stripping of "unneeded" messages is good, and should happen at the > > > package generation level (not in GNOME, or when creating tarballs). > > > > You talk about memory savings, but do calculations based on file sizes. > > That's doesn't work. > > Aren't mo files mapped to memory?
Yes, they're mapped. That doesn't result in actual memory usage. The kernel will make sure they're only read into memory as needed. _______________________________________________ desktop-devel-list mailing list desktop-devel-list@gnome.org http://mail.gnome.org/mailman/listinfo/desktop-devel-list
